High-power mining wheel loaders handle demanding loading cycles across mines, quarries and large aggregate operations. This ranking compares six Komatsu and Cat models, looking beyond engine output to operating weight, bucket capacity, breakout force, payload and truck matching.
The Komatsu WE2350 leads the group with 2,300 hp and a 72.6-ton standard payload, followed by the purpose-built WA900-8 at 899 hp. The Cat 988 and Komatsu WA600-8 cover heavy quarry and mining production, while the Cat 980 and WA500-8 are better suited to quarry, stockpile and mine-support work.

High-Power Mining Wheel Loaders FAQ.
The Komatsu WE2350 is by far the most powerful at 2,300 hp / 1,715 kW. It also carries a 72.6-ton standard payload and weighs about 266.6 tons in standard-lift configuration.
The Komatsu WE2350 has the largest bucket in this group. Its standard rock bucket is 40.52 m³, while the super-high-lift configuration can use a 53.5 m³ bucket for lower-density materials.
Yes. The WA900-8 produces 899 hp compared with 580 hp for the Cat 988. It is also substantially heavier at around 116.4 tons compared with approximately 51.1 tons for the 988.
The Cat 980 is officially classified as a medium wheel loader rather than a dedicated surface-mining loader. However, Caterpillar specifies it for demanding work including pit applications, and its size makes it useful for quarry, aggregate, stockpile, and mine-support duties.
Mining-focused loaders combine higher engine output with heavier structures, larger buckets, greater payload capability, stronger cooling and driveline systems, and components designed for repeated production cycles. Purpose-built machines such as the WE2350 and WA900-8 are also sized specifically around loading large mining haul trucks.
